Let’s Talk: Without Direct Support Professionals in My Life, I Don’t Have a Life

Sep 22, 2022 | Events, News, Webinars

This month, we are revisiting the August issue of The International Journal for Direct Support Professionals, “Without Direct Support Professionals in My Life, I Don’t Have a Life.” On the next Let’s Talk webinar, self-advocate Bob Peterson and NADSP Director of Educational Services John Raffaele discuss self-determination and the importance of direct support professionals in Bob’s life. Bob and John will discuss how Bob’s quality of life is made possible through the work of direct support professionals. Additionally, they offer practical and realistic actions that can improve the status of direct support professionals.

This webinar is a companion to the August International Journal for DIrect Support Professionals issue, Without Direct Support Professionals in My Life, I Don’t Have a Life.”
